Ibn Sina, often known as Avicenna, was a Persian polymath who made important contributions to varied fields, together with medicine and philosophy. He was born in 980 in the village of Afshana, close to Bukhara, in present-day Uzbekistan. His father, Abdullah, was a respected scholar and authorities official, and he ensured that Ibn Sina received an extensive education from an early age. Ibn Sina confirmed exceptional mental qualities and commenced finding out a variety of subjects, such as mathematics, astronomy, and drugs, in a younger age. He rapidly mastered these disciplines and began to develop his have theories and concepts.

In the age of sixteen, Ibn Sina commenced learning medicine underneath the direction of a neighborhood doctor. He immediately received a status for his health-related knowledge and competencies, and he was shortly treating people on his possess. His thirst for knowledge led him to review different professional medical texts from diverse cultures and traditions, such as Greek, Indian, and Persian resources. This broad publicity to different health care traditions would later affect his have health care theories and practices. Besides medicine, Ibn Sina also analyzed philosophy, logic, and metaphysics, and he turned effectively-versed during the will work of Aristotle along with other historical Greek philosophers. His early education laid the foundation for his later on contributions to drugs and philosophy.

Operates and Legacy


Ibn Sina's most famous operate is "The Canon of Drugs," a comprehensive professional medical encyclopedia that grew to become an ordinary healthcare textual content in both the Islamic entire world and Europe for hundreds of years. The Canon of Medicine was divided into 5 guides and coated a wide array of medical subjects, together with anatomy, physiology, pathology, pharmacology, and therapeutics. Additionally, it provided detailed descriptions of ailments as well as their treatment plans, in addition to discussions of preventive medication and community health and fitness. The Canon of Drugs was a groundbreaking function that synthesized the health-related familiarity with enough time and experienced an enduring influence on the event of drugs.

In addition to "The Canon of Medicine," Ibn Sina wrote many other operates on medication, philosophy, astronomy, along with other subjects. His philosophical treatises, for example "The E book of Therapeutic" and "The Ebook of Salvation," ended up influential in equally the Islamic earth and Europe. These will work protected a wide array of philosophical subjects, which includes metaphysics, ethics, logic, and theology. Ibn Sina's writings had a profound impact on the event of Islamic philosophy and had a lasting influence on Western thought as well.
